@font-face{font-family:monster of fantasy;src:url(/fonts/monster-of-fantasy.woff2)format('woff2')}h1,h2,h3,h4,h5,h6{font-family:monster of fantasy,serif}html{background-color:#000}body{background-color:#000;color:#fff;display:flex;flex-direction:column;font-family:noto serif display,monster of fantasy,serif;font-weight:Regular;line-height:1.5;margin:0 auto;max-width:1200px}a{color:#fff;text-decoration:none}a:hover{text-shadow:1px 0 15px}h3+ul,h2+h3{margin-top:20px}ul+h3{margin-top:40px}ul+h2{margin-top:60px}p+p{margin-top:20px}main ul{display:flex;flex-direction:column;gap:10px}main h2:has(+.page-content){text-align:center;margin-bottom:30px}body:not([data-is-home=true]){padding:0 20px}body:not([data-is-home=true]) header{background:url(/images/si-te-contara-el-amor-en-tres-poemas.jpg)50% 0 no-repeat;background-size:contain;max-width:1200px;aspect-ratio:3/1}.topbar__menu{position:relative;font-family:monster of fantasy,serif}.topbar__menu{display:flex;flex-direction:row;gap:72px;color:#fff;padding:48px 32px 0}.topbar__menu h1{font-weight:unset;font-size:42px;height:50px}.nav-wrapper{width:100%}.topbar__menu nav{height:50px;width:100%}.topbar__menu nav>ul{display:flex;flex-direction:row;align-items:flex-end;justify-content:space-between;height:100%;list-style:none;padding-inline-start:unset}.topbar__menu nav>ul>li>a{color:#fff;font-size:24px}.topbar__menu nav>ul>li>a:hover{color:#fff}.topbar__menu nav>ul:has(a[aria-current=page].active)>li>a:not([aria-current=page].active){color:rgba(255 255 255/75%)}.topbar__menu>.hamburger-menu{display:none}.page-content{font-size:1.1rem;line-height:1.7}footer{color:#fff}.social-media{padding-top:30px}@media screen and (min-width:1081px){.social-icons li:not(:last-child){margin-right:0}.social-icons{margin:0}.social-icons li a svg{width:30px;height:30px}#social-navigation .social-icons{display:flex;flex-direction:row;align-items:center;justify-content:right;padding-inline-end:20px}}@media screen and (max-width:1080px){body{width:100%;max-width:1080px}body:not([data-is-home=true]){padding:unset}body:not([data-is-home=true]) main{padding:0 20px}.topbar__menu{justify-content:space-between;color:#fff;padding:8px 12px 0 8px}.topbar__menu h1{font-weight:unset;font-size:28px;height:32px}.topbar__menu>.nav-wrapper>nav{height:100vh}.topbar__menu>.nav-wrapper>nav>ul{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;gap:20px}.topbar__menu>.nav-wrapper>nav>ul>li>a{font-size:20px}footer{display:flex;flex-direction:column;justify-content:center;font-size:14px;height:50px}footer p{text-align:center}.social-icons{margin:0}.social-icons li a svg{width:22px;height:22px}#social-navigation .social-icons{display:flex;flex-direction:row;align-items:center;justify-content:center;padding-inline-end:10px}}main.music-page>.page-content{display:flex;flex-direction:column;gap:20px;align-items:center}main.music-page img{height:auto}main.music-page>.page-content figure a:hover{border:2px solid #b9358a!important;display:block}